## Further Reading

Ledgerlens is the audit-log viewer for the Varnholt platform. It reads append-only event streams; it never writes. Access is scoped per role, and all queries are themselves logged. For review purposes, note that retention is 400 days and redaction follows the Quillmark policy set. Export requires dual approval. Threat model, signing scheme, and tamper-evidence design are documented separately. The full security architecture notes, including the verification procedure for stream hashes, are on the internal page below.

operations page: https://jira.qorvelsys.internal/browse/pages/browse/pages

- [ ] Raffle drums, staff party: pick up both brass-trim raffle drums from the Pellward Hall storeroom and deliver them to the Briarcote function room before 16:00 setup. Check that the ticket hatches are latched and the stands are strapped to the drums, as they came loose last year. Use the padded blankets from the van kit, not loose bubble wrap. Tick off against the events inventory sheet and have the venue steward initial receipt. The one-line courier hand-over instruction is appended directly beneath this item.

courier memo of yahif-faweg: the quenael tamius courier leaves the prawyn jorix kaswyn istox silmir brieth zormir fenvan ledger at gate 3145 under passcode 231062

Finance Review — Northvale Region, H1. Quick summary for sales leads: Northvale came in 8% ahead of plan, mostly on the Drayton product line. Margins slipped a touch due to aggressive bundle pricing — worth watching. Pipeline coverage for H2 looks thin in the western districts, so expect some target rebalancing. Expense discipline was solid overall. Good half, but don't coast. The confidential outlook for the region is noted just below.

internal memo for kawip-hadug: Headcount on the Wenwyn team goes from 7 to 140 by the end of January. Gross margin on Wenwyn came in at 20 percent against a plan of 15 percent.